Transaction 93d74256c756a881995d0ece108096b00557b78febf773a77043ab6119f183c8
1 Input
1 Output
-
93d74256c756a881995d0ece108096b00557b78febf773a77043ab6119f183c8:0
- value
- 141112
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09de47f9fc30cd5ffee5e8ec2a55e5544bbf7732 OP_EQUAL
- address
- 32bCHdqHJteSVRbSb3f6YQJN2Y2uqXqUbT